1.2 Category Snapshot

A bath pillow (also known as a bathtub pillow, bathtub headrest, or bath cushion) is an accessory specifically designed to enhance bathing comfort. It is typically attached to the inner wall of a bathtub via suction cups, aiming to provide soft support for the user's head, neck, shoulders, and even upper back, alleviating discomfort caused by the hard bathtub edge. Mainstream products often use breathable mesh materials, emphasizing quick-drying and easy cleaning, intending to elevate the daily bathing experience into a relaxing, spa-like indulgence at home. III. User Needs Hierarchy Analysis (KANO Model)

3.1 Basic Needs (Must-Haves)

  • Secure Adhesion: The bath pillow must firmly adhere to the bathtub wall, ensuring it does not slip or detach during use. This is the fundamental requirement for safety and basic experience.
  • Basic Head Support: Provides softer, more comfortable support for the head and neck compared to the hard bathtub edge, avoiding direct contact with the cold, hard surface.
  • Water-Resistant Material: The pillow material should withstand humid environments, not absorb water excessively, and resist becoming waterlogged.

3.2 Performance Needs

  • Ergonomic Design: The pillow's shape and filling should conform to the natural curves of the neck, shoulders, and back, providing balanced, comfortable support and relieving localized pressure.
  • Quick-Dry & Breathable: Uses materials like 3D/4D/5D mesh fabric to ensure free water and air flow for rapid drying, effectively inhibiting bacterial growth.
  • Soft & Skin-Friendly: The fabric feels soft and smooth against the skin, without causing scratching or irritation, enhancing direct contact comfort.
  • Easy to Clean: The product should be hand or machine washable, ideally coming with a laundry bag and hook for easy deep cleaning and fast drying/maintenance.
  • Universal Compatibility: Adapts to various types and sizes of bathtubs (freestanding, built-in, jetted tubs, etc.), offering broad applicability.

3.3 Excitement Needs (Delighters)

  • Full-Body Relaxation Experience: Provides support extending to shoulders, back, or even the entire upper body, transforming a regular bath into an immersive, full-body spa-like experience for deeper relaxation.
  • High-Quality Feel & Luxurious Ambiance: Uses premium materials, fine craftsmanship, and sophisticated packaging to create a sense of luxury and ritual, enhancing user psychological satisfaction.
  • Aesthetics & Personalization: Unique appearance (e.g., jellyfish shape), diverse color options cater to users' desire for bathroom aesthetics and personal expression, increasing visual pleasure.
  • Complete Accessory Set: Includes high-quality laundry bags, drying hooks, storage bags, or suction cup removal tools, enhancing convenience and perceived value, demonstrating brand attention to detail.

3.4 Unmet Needs & Market Gaps

  • Poor Long-Term Suction Cup Stability: Many users report suction cups work initially but tend to loosen, lose adhesion, or detach after several uses or over time, especially on textured or wet tub surfaces.
    User Reviews (VOC)
    Suction cups falling off // Does not stick well.It slides out of place // Suction cups detached after 1 month of use
  • Non-Lasting Anti-Mold/Anti-Bacterial Effect: Even with quick-dry mesh claims, users still report mold spots or odors developing with prolonged use, difficult to remove even after cleaning.
    User Reviews (VOC)
    it will start to get the red dots (mold?) if you don't. // Mold on pillow // It retains water and doesn't dry quickly, so you'll need to wash it frequently to avoid mold or smells
  • Material Durability Needs Improvement: Users report issues like torn stitching, suction cups detaching from the pillow body, or overall breakage, shortening the product's lifespan.
    User Reviews (VOC)
    the back plastic part ripped off // one of the suction cups came off and the fabric around the area makes it so that it's impossible to get it back on
  • Insufficient Sensitivity-Skin Friendliness: Some mesh fabrics are still reported as 'scratchy' or 'rough' when wet, not fully meeting all users' needs for ultimate skin-friendliness.
    User Reviews (VOC)
    the material is so scratchy to me I have to put a rag or hand towel over it to be comfortable to soak in the tub // the mesh fabric is a little scratchy

V. Category Selling Points & Competitive Landscape

5.1 Product Selling Point Analysis

5.1.1 Common Selling Points

  • Comfortable Support: Widely emphasizes ergonomic design for soft, comfortable support of the head, neck, shoulders, and even back to relieve fatigue.
  • Non-Slip Suction Cups: Almost all products advertise multiple (6-7 is common, some up to 54) strong suction cups to ensure the pillow stays firmly in place.
  • Quick-Dry & Breathable: Most use 3D or 4D mesh (Air Mesh) material, claiming breathability, fast drying, and effective prevention of mold and odors.
  • Easy to Clean: Commonly promoted as machine washable, often including a hook for easy hanging and drying, simplifying user maintenance.
  • Universal Compatibility: Emphasizes suitability for various bathtub types and sizes (freestanding, built-in, jetted tubs, etc.) to broaden market coverage.

5.1.2 Differentiating Selling Points

  • Upgraded Mesh Fabric: Some products use '4D Air Mesh', '5D Mesh Fabric', or even 'Spacer Mesh', emphasizing a softer, more breathable, more elastic upgraded experience.
  • Extra Thick Padding: Highlights 'Extra Thick padding', '3.5/3.9-inch thickness', or '8cm elastic polyester fiber' for superior cushioning and stronger support.
  • Increased Suction Cup Quantity/Size: Enhances adhesion stability and strength by increasing the number (e.g., 54 small cups) or size (e.g., 3-inch large cups) of suction cups.
  • Full-Body Support: Some designs extend support to shoulders and upper back, offering a more comprehensive relaxation experience, differentiating from neck-only products.
  • Additional Accessories: Includes high-quality laundry bags, storage bags, or suction cup removal tools, increasing product value-add and user convenience.

5.1.3 Unique Selling Propositions (USPs)

  • TPE New Material: A few products experiment with TPE material, emphasizing its unique flexibility and elasticity for a novel tactile and support experience.
  • Jellyfish Shape Design: One product features a unique 'jellyfish' shape, attracting specific user groups, especially as a children's item or gift, with its cute and novel appearance.
  • Packaging Usage Tips: Some products include helpful tips on packaging/details pages, like 'Soak in warm water for 30 minutes before first use to restore shape', focusing on initial user experience details.
  • Patented Design Claim: Individual brands (e.g., AmazeFan) emphasize having a 'US Patented Design', attempting to build technical barriers and brand uniqueness, enhancing credibility.
  • Waterproof Vinyl-Wrapped Foam: A few products (e.g., certain GORILLA GRIP models) use waterproof vinyl wrapped over thick foam, emphasizing non-absorbency and easy wipe-drying, differentiating from mainstream mesh materials.

5.2 Competitive Landscape Observation

5.2.1 Market Maturity

The bath pillow category exhibits a medium-high level of market maturity. Core functionalities and promotional selling points have become standardized, primarily revolving around comfort, slip resistance, and ease of cleaning. Competition among brands is intense, with many products showing high homogeneity in appearance and basic functions, leading to significant price pressure. Nonetheless, the market continues to seek incremental differentiation through innovations in material technology, ergonomic design, and suction cup technology to capture limited market share.

5.2.2 Market Innovation Trends

Innovation trends are primarily evident in material upgrades, such as evolving from basic 3D mesh to more advanced 4D/5D mesh fabrics for better breathability, softness, and elasticity. Some products also experiment with new flexible materials like TPE or use waterproof vinyl-wrapped foam to more effectively address quick-drying and anti-mold issues. Furthermore, suction cup technology is constantly optimized, including increasing quantity, enlarging size, and improving structure for better adhesion and easier removal. Product design is expanding from simple head/neck support to shoulder/back or even full-body support, and beginning to incorporate more aesthetic and emotional elements, such as unique shapes and an emphasis on gifting attributes, seeking differentiation breakthroughs in a homogenized market.

VI. Market Fit Analysis

6.1 Alignment Analysis

In the current bath pillow market, there is a notable mix of alignment and misalignment between sellers' promotional focus and buyers' actual experiences or needs.

Areas of Alignment and Misalignment: Sellers commonly highlight 'Comfortable Support' and 'Easy Cleaning/Quick-Dry' as core selling points, which aligns highly with buyers' focus on seeking relaxation and maintaining hygiene. For instance, many products emphasize their 'Ergonomic Design', the softness and breathability from '4D/5D Air Mesh' materials, and features like 'Machine Washable' and 'Built-in Hook' for convenient cleaning and drying. These promotions effectively target the user's desire to upgrade bathing to a worry-free spa experience. However, a severe disconnect occurs regarding the extremely critical aspect of 'Suction Cup Reliability'. While almost all products claim 'Strong Suction Cups' or 'Non-Slip Design', substantial user feedback points to cups being unreliable, prone to slipping, or even detaching/breaking after some use. This indicates that sellers' marketing claims in this area often fail to reflect actual product performance, leading to unmet expectations and directly impacting the core functional experience and user satisfaction. Additionally, for 'Material Skin-Friendliness' and 'Product Durability', sellers often use vague terms like 'Ultra-Soft' or 'High Quality', whereas users complain about materials being 'scratchy' or products having a 'short lifespan', representing further misalignment between marketing and real-world perception.

Verifying Marketing Promises Against Objective Reality: Beyond individual product quality issues, the suction cup reliability problem also faces challenges from objective physical laws. Bathtub surfaces vary (smooth porcelain, textured, cast iron, acrylic), and suction cup adhesion is inherently affected by wet conditions. When sellers uniformly claim 'Fits All Bathtubs' and 'Stays Firmly in Place' without their suction cup technology genuinely overcoming these physical barriers, it creates a conflict between 'Over-Promising and Objective Reality'. For example, certain suction cups might perform acceptably on smooth surfaces but fail on rough or textured tub walls. Similarly, even with 4D/5D mesh claims of 'Quick-Dry & Anti-Mold', if the filling material remains absorbent or the design hinders complete drainage, mold can still develop in the long-term humid environment. This isn't necessarily poor quality but indicates the product's physical properties or design haven't fully conquered the challenges of a damp setting; thus, claiming absolute effects like 'Permanent Anti-Mold' can constitute factual misalignment. Regarding 'Extra Thick Padding' claims, if over-emphasis on softness sacrifices support, or if the filling sags/deforms over time, it creates a factual gap with consumer expectations for 'Support Strength'.

In summary, the bath pillow market shows reasonable performance in meeting basic user needs for comfort and cleanliness. However, systematic misalignment exists between current products/marketing promises and user expectations regarding solving the core pain points of 'Suction Cup Stability' and 'Long-Term Anti-Mold/Anti-Bacterial Efficacy', particularly involving risks of over-promising relative to physical limitations and product durability.
